What Makes Concrete Eco-Friendly?



Environment-friendly concrete is made to lower its carbon impact while still performing like conventional mixes. Some methods utilize recycled materials such as crushed glass or slag from industrial waste. Others incorporate carbon capture techniques, minimizing emissions during manufacturing. There are also concrete kinds that can take in contamination from the air, assisting to clean urban settings.



Yet sustainability does not stop with ingredients. It also consists of durability. Eco-friendly blends commonly last longer and withstand weathering, which implies less repair services and replacements down the line. That makes them not simply an environment-friendly choice, but a clever investment.

Urban Planning and Green Infrastructure



As cities look toward the future, green materials are ending up being crucial. Districts are integrating sustainable concrete into walkways, public plazas, and also stormwater monitoring systems. Because environmentally friendly concrete can be crafted for leaks in the structure, it helps reduce runoff and support natural groundwater recharge-- two big wins for metropolitan areas taking care of regular flooding and water lacks.

The Role of Local Sourcing and Waste Reduction



In the past, construction often relied upon products shipped over cross countries, boosting discharges and costs. With eco-friendly concrete, most of the raw materials can be sourced locally, minimizing transportation influences. Furthermore, using commercial byproducts like fly ash or recycled accumulations helps draw away waste from landfills and gives new life to what would or else be discarded.
